React2】的更多相关文章

1.属性 a. 属性和状态是react中数据传递的载体: b. 属性是声明以后不允许被修改的东西: c. 属性只能在组件初始化的时候声明并传入组件内部,并且在组件内部通过this.props获取: d. 组件内可以通过getDefaultProps声明默认属性 2.状态 a. 是声明以后可以用来改变的,在组件中通过getInitialState进行声明: b. this.state进行获取状态,通过setState进行修改: c. 状态修改组件会发生二次渲染,react组件中render方法会重…
<body><!-- React 真实 DOM 将会插入到这里 --><div id="example"></div> <!-- 引入 React --><script src="src/libs/react.js"></script><!-- 引入 JSX 语法格式转换器 --><script src="src/libs/JSXTransformer.j…
react基础(1):介绍了如何创建项目,总结了JSX.组件.样式.事件.state.props.refs.map循环,另外还讲了mock数据和ajax 还是用 react基础1 里创建的项目继续写案例. react-router 在做单页面应用的时候就需要用到路由了. 首先来看一下我们的项目目录,如下所示: package.json和webpack.config.js的内容和 react基础(1)一样的. 下面贴一下entries里的文件内容 react2/src/entries/index.…
使用 create-react-app 快速构建 React 开发环境 1.cnpm install -g create-react-app 2.create-react-app react2(react2是项目名字) 3.cd react2 4.npm start 如下图已经成功创建项目.可以看到初始化的项目目录结构.…
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F-8"> <title>Title</title> <script src="https://cdn.bootcss.com/react/15.4.2/react.min.js"></script> <script src=&quo…
一: Support for the experimental syntax 'classProperties' isn't currently enabled ERROR in ./src/index.js Module build failed (from ./node_modules/_babel-loader@8.0.5@babel-loader/lib/index.js): SyntaxError: F:\Front-end items\vs code\react-2\src\inde…
一 概念 1 Hybird App,是用现有前端(html,js,css)技术来开发的app.特点:1 灵活(开发灵活 ,部署灵活) 2 拥有类似原生的性能体验. 2 不是h5页面,也不是在webview里面加载的. 而是通过例如webpack打包工具生成的js bundle资源文件,放到原生本地渲染(原生需集成环境). 二 优点 1 拥有web/h5的灵活性,支持随时热更新(增量更新); 同时拥有原生app的性能. 2 编写一次, 多端通用,跨平台,体验一致. 3 组件可以modules和co…
参考资料:http://easywork.xin/2018/09/02/react-2/ 我拿到的设计图 是  375px //配置px2rem px2rem({remUnit: 37.5})   在index.html 加以下的script <script>document.getElementsByTagName('html')[0].style.fontSize = (document.documentElement.clientWidth || document.body.client…
博客侧边栏公告(支持HTML代码)(支持JS代码) <div id='btnList'> <a class="ivu-btn ivu-btn-primary" href="https://cn.vuejs.org/v2/api/" target="_blank">Vue</a> <a class="ivu-btn ivu-btn-primary" href="https://…
docs search & algolia & docsearch https://www.algolia.com/docsearch https://www.algolia.com/doc/api-client/getting-started/install/javascript/ https://github.com/algolia/algoliasearch-client-javascript install # js $ npm i -S algoliasearch # TypeS…